# Break-Glass: Catalog Cache Invalidation

Scope: the Pinrow product catalog at Veldstone Retail. If stale prices persist after a purge and the Hollowmere invalidation queue is wedged, use break-glass to flush the edge tier directly. Contractors: get verbal sign-off from the catalog lead first. Steps: open the Hollowmere admin shell, select emergency-flush, confirm the tenant, and run it once — repeated flushes thrash the origin. Access is logged and expires after 20 minutes. Unseal the admin shell with the passphrase below.

recovery phrase for kahop-tajog: istix-casvan

**Break-Glass Access: SquatterNet Scanner**

SquatterNet, our typo-squatting package scanner, runs under a locked service account. If the scanner pipeline stalls and a release is blocked, reviewers may invoke break-glass access to restart the verdict engine manually. Use this only when both maintainers on the Quillbrook team are unreachable, and file an incident note afterward. To unseal the break-glass credential bundle, enter the recovery passphrase given below.

unlock words, fahop-yageg: ralwyn-kelath

Deploy guide, step 6 — StormRelay fan-out service (Cloudmere Weather Systems)

StormRelay takes severe-weather alerts from the Ingest tier and fans them out to regional notifier pods. Before starting the service, verify FANOUT_REGIONS lists every active region and FANOUT_RETRY_MAX is at least 5, since dropped alerts are unacceptable. Double-check that the health endpoint responds before enabling traffic. The fan-out publisher authenticates against the message broker using a credential, which you set on the line immediately below.

env line for fafof-fahag: LEDGER_TOKEN5=f8790